How Many People Are Named Beckham?
An estimated 18,215 people in the United States have the first name Beckham. It is predominantly male (98.6%). The average bearer is 8 years old, and Beckham peaked in popularity in 2024 with 2,239 births that year.

Gender Distribution for Beckham
Beckham is predominantly male (98.6%), though 260 female births have been registered. It functions as a unisex name for a small percentage of bearers.

Beckham: Popularity Over Time
SSA records for Beckham span from the 1900s to the 2020s, covering 5 decades of naming data. The most popular decade for this name was the 2020s, when 9,140 babies were registered. Beckham remains highly popular today, with recent registration numbers near its historical peak.

Beckham by State
Birth registrations for Beckham span all 49 states and territories in the SSA database. The highest counts are in Texas, Utah, California. The lowest are in Wyoming, Vermont, Hawaii. On average, about 354 Beckhams were registered per state.

Where does this data come from?
Our estimates use Social Security Administration birth records (1880 to 2024), adjusted for survival using CDC 2023 life tables broken down by sex. The U.S. population figure (342,754,338) is from the Census Bureau's July 2025 estimate. Full methodology.
